I believe Bitcoin currently enjoys the property that during an "innocent" re-org, i.e. a reorg in which no affected transactions are being double spent, all affected transactions can always eventually get replayed, so long as the re-org depth is less than 100.

My concern with this proposed operation is that it would destroy this property.

On Fri, Sep 23, 2016 at 5:57 AM, Luke Dashjr via bitcoin-dev <bitcoin-dev@lists.linuxfoundation.org> wrote:
This BIP describes a new opcode (OP_CHECKBLOCKATHEIGHT) for the Bitcoin
scripting system to address reissuing bitcoin transactions when the coins they
spend have been conflicted/double-spent.


Does this seem like a good idea/approach?

bitcoin-dev mailing list